Thyroid Nodules With Indeterminate Cytology: Is It Safe To Say 'Thyroidectomy Can Be Excluded If F-18-Fdg-Pet Suggests Benignity'?

Abstract
We read with interest the article by Rosario et al., which summarized the practical applicability of accessible imaging method in the management of thyroid nodules with indeterminate cytologically (TNIC) (Rosario, et al. 2021). For 18F-FDG-PET, it was stated that \"a nodule characterized by low or absent 18F-FDG uptake is considered at a very low risk of malignance\", and \"thyroidectomy can be excluded if these tests suggest benignity\". We respectfully want to share a different opinion based on our previous work.
